Applying the Medicinal Value of Books: Bibliotherapy

Applying books as therapeutic tools, bibliotherapy has been deeply investigated and found beneficial in helping children tackle a variety of emotional and behavioral challenges. This approach substantially boosts children’s ability to recognize and manage their emotions, contributing to their overall mental health.

Anecdotes and Social Skills: Linking Communication Disparities

For children, notably those with developmental challenges such as autism, anecdotes can be a lifeline to grasping complex social cues. Narrative-based interventions have been revealed to notably better social skills by providing clear examples of social interactions.
